Bright early color for gardens and containers
Mixrug 302 Mixed Perennial Primrose Seeds bring a burst of color as late-winter light strengthens and days lengthen. Expect a soft tapestry of pink, purple, white, and yellow from a single seed packet, with a light, floral fragrance that enhances outdoor spaces and invites exploration.
What makes these primroses stand out
- Over 300 seeds per packet to help you design expansive displays in beds or containers.
- Delicate double blooms with layered petals add texture and visual interest to borders and edging.
- Subtle fragrance contributes to a welcoming garden atmosphere during bloom.
- Reliable perennial for USDA zones 5–8, with cold tolerance that can carry through late frosts.
Garden and container versatility
- Compact growth habit makes them suitable for borders, pathways, and underplanting shrubs.
- Excellent choice for planters, window boxes, and patio pots that crave continuous color.
- Pairs well with early-season companions like dwarf grasses or tulips for layered display.
Growing guidance and long-term value
These primroses are perennials that reappear each spring, often with increased vigor as they establish in your beds or containers. With proper moisture and well-drained soil, you can enjoy repeated cycles of color, texture, and fragrance across the season. While results can vary by site, many gardeners find they establish quickly in sunny to lightly shaded spots and reward careful planning with ongoing blooms.
